Understanding LED Lumens and Lux
What are LED Lumens?
LED Lumens measure the total amount of visible light emitted by a source. This metric is crucial in evaluating how much light a fixture can produce. When choosing lighting for a jobsite, higher lumens indicate greater brightness, making it easier to see fine details and perform precise tasks.
In contrast, focusing only on LED Lumens without considering other factors may lead to excess energy use. Therefore, it’s essential to choose lighting that combines high lumens with efficiency.
What is Lux and How Does it Affect Lighting?
Lux measures the illumination of a surface, calculated as lumens per square meter. This unit helps to understand how light is distributed across a space, which is particularly important in large or unevenly shaped worksites.
Lux affects the quality of the lighting, ensuring a work area is lit evenly. Proper consideration of lux can lead to improved safety and reduce shadows that might obstruct visibility.
Factors to Consider in Choosing Jobsite Lighting
Brightness Intensity Requirements
First, assess the tasks that need lighting. Tasks requiring high detail, like electrical work, benefit from higher brightness. Evaluating brightness ensures that the lighting aligns with the demands of the jobsite, minimizing eye strain and fatigue.
Energy Efficiency Considerations
Energy-efficient lighting can significantly lower operational costs. Opting for LED lighting, which offers high lumens while consuming less power, is a smart choice for maintaining cost-efficiency without sacrificing brightness.
Durability and Longevity Factors
Durability is essential for jobsite lighting to withstand harsh environments. Choose lights known for their longevity and ability to endure the elements, ensuring consistent performance over time.
Moreover, reliable lighting reduces the frequency of replacements, saving both time and resources.

FAQs
What is the difference between LED Lumens and Lux?
Lumens measure total light output, while lux is about the distribution of that light over a given area, affecting brightness perception.
How do I determine the right jobsite lighting based on my real needs?
Evaluate the tasks, consider lumen output for brightness, lux for distribution, and ensure durability and efficiency.
Are there any energy-saving options for jobsite lighting?
Yes, LEDs are the most energy-efficient, providing high lumen output with lower power consumption.
